Browsing Cart Check: Are You Getting Scammed?

So you've found the dream item online. Your heart are set on it, and you're ready to checkout. But hold on! Before you complete your order, take a moment to conduct a detailed ghost cart check. This little trick can assist you from falling victim to scams and ensuring you get exactly what you ordered.

  • Watch for websites with suspicious layouts, missing contact information, or flagrant prices.
  • Verify the website's URL and make sure it's authentic. Look for "https" at the beginning of the address and a padlock symbol in your browser's address bar.
  • Research the website and seller before committing. Check online forums, review sites, and social media for any red flags.

Don't Get Ripped Off: How to Spot Fake Platinum Vapes

Wanna escape getting cheated? It's more prevalent than you think! Numerous fake platinum vapes are out there, and they can be extremely dangerous.

Here's how to tell if your vape is the real deal:

  • Examine the packaging. It should be high-quality, with clear branding and precise product information.
  • Scrutinize the vape itself. It should feel solid in your hand, not cheap or artificial
  • Observe the identification number. It should be visible and individual.
  • Do your research. Learn about reliable brands and sellers.

Remember, when it comes to vaping, safety should always be your number one concern. Don't take the gamble with your health - purchase from reliable sellers!
